57 The Crosspath is a 106 m² / 1,141 sq ft terraced home in Radlett. It sold for £650,000 in November 2023.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£662k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£632k to £871k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.

-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£661,860.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Radlett are now selling for between £5,960 and £8,220 per square metre (£553 and £763 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 106 m², this implies a valuation between £632,000 and £871,000. Treat this as context only.
